BHF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review
437 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Brighthouse Financial (BHF)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$3.81B — up 5.2% from $3.62B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 66 funds closed out of BHF and 50 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 161 trimmed existing stakes and 113 added.
The largest buyer was Arrowstreet Capital, adding an estimated $41M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$42.9M.
